What is the Horse Riding Agreement and Liability Release Form?
The Horse Riding Agreement and Liability Release Form serves as a legal document for equestrian facilities in California, such as Cottonwood Farms and B and B Training Stables. It defines the risks involved in horse riding and outlines the responsibilities of both the rider and the facility. By signing this document, riders acknowledge the inherent dangers and agree to relieve the facility from liability in the event of an injury.
This form is crucial for ensuring that both parties understand their roles and responsibilities, thereby enhancing safety during equestrian activities.

Who Needs the Horse Riding Agreement and Liability Release Form?
Every rider participating in horseback riding activities is required to complete and sign the Horse Riding Agreement and Liability Release Form. For minor riders, it is essential that a parent or guardian also signs the document to provide consent and acknowledgment of the associated risks. Specific scenarios where this form is critical include riding lessons, trail rides, and competitions.
Ultimately, the form is designed to protect both the riders and the equestrian facility by ensuring that all necessary acknowledgments are formally documented.

Who needs to sign the Horse Riding Agreement and Liability Release Form?
Both the rider and their parent or guardian must sign the Horse Riding Agreement and Liability Release Form, especially if the rider is a minor. This ensures all parties understand the inherent risks involved in horseback riding.
Is there a deadline for submitting the Horse Riding Agreement and Liability Release Form?
It's advisable to submit the Horse Riding Agreement and Liability Release Form prior to the scheduled riding session. This allows sufficient time for review and ensures compliance with safety regulations at the riding facility.

Is notarization required for this form?
No, the Horse Riding Agreement and Liability Release Form does not require notarization. However, it must be signed by the necessary parties to be valid.
